Default HOW TO: Bootloader and hard reset without the stylus

+++Instructions+++
The key is, the phone needs to be powered down, not just the screen.
These are some of the ways to power down your phone.
1) If you have psShutXP installed, you can select "Shut Down".
2) or, Push and hold the power button. You will be warned that you're shutting down the phone.
3) or, Remove the battery.

Once you're phone is powered down, decide which mode you want to go into.
Make sure the "PowerButton" is the last button you push and hold, since that will turn your phone on.

Note: Push and hold all the corresponding buttons to activate selected mode

Bootloader = VolumeDown + PowerButton
Triggered Bootloader = VolumeDown + BackArrow + PowerButton
Hardreset = VolumeDown + OK + PowerButton

**Edit**
I did a little more research, and this is called entering "Triggered bootloader mode" as apposed to the normal bootloader mode.


The way bootloader/triggered bootloader/hard-reset works is the fact that you are holding down certain buttons while the phone powers up.
Using the stylus to reset the phone is just a way of making the phone shutoff and turn back on while you are holding the buttons.
So, if you have your phone powered down and hold the appropriate buttons while powering the phone back on, you will enter whatever mode you want.

Just to reiterate what cornelious2 said, Triggered Bootloader is what you use when you want to flash a rom from the internal storage.
You just take a RUU_Signed.nbh and rename it DIAMIMG.nbh and place it on the root of your internal storage folder.


Symptoms that may mean you need to force bootloader: (credit to Meatgel)

Stuck on the screen with red letters
Soft reset turns to a hard reset
You're in a re-boot cycle
Anytime you pull the battery from a freeze and the phone doesn't boot correctly

After you put your phone in bootloader it may be best to flash to a stock or shipped ROM before flashing to your choice of custom ROMs.

+++Devices that can use this method+++
These devices can enter bootloader or hard reset using the correct button combination for that device, w/o the stylus.
If anyone has more info, please let me know, and I'll update this list.

Same steps apply.
Power off the phone, and then press and hold the correct buttons, pushing the power button last.
If you're not sure how to power down your phone, remove the battery.

Devices

HTC Apache - Bootloader and Hard reset
HTC Vogue - Bootloader and Hard reset
HTC Touch Pro - Bootloader and Hard reset
